ARM (1995 - 2006)

ARM is the sound of passionate nerds, introvert storytellers and moody conductors. They gathered around a table while attentively turning knobs and pushing buttons on a pile of gadgets, as if hoping for it to come to life, to stand up and join them.

ARM melts music with one hand and makes new music with the other and throws it at you with the third! Starting in improvisation, ARM serves as a musical meeting point where anything can happen. Part lab and part playground, all plans are put aside and results become clear over time. So, when other musicians are invited to join, this becomes music of constant change.

What remains constant is the desire for experimentation and an inclusive approach to sound and noise. With this in mind, ARM can be described as musical relatives to acts such as Farmers Manual, Stillupsteypa, Supersilent, Boredoms and Black Dice.

ARM has throughout a number of concerts invited musicians to their Blisterpack Series; instrumentalists who meet ARM for improvisation, for testing of strength and common conspiring. Examples are Toshimaru Nakamura, Lasse Marhaug, John Hegre, Salvatore, Pål Asle Petersen, Håkon Kornstad, Tonny Kluften and Jørgen Træen.

Associated ARM members:
Are Mokkelbost, Arne Borgan, Alexander Rishaug, Øyvind Stoveland Berg, Marius Von Der Fehr, Chris Reddy and Steven Cuzner.
